How to Evaluate a Business Opportunity

Before making any investment, carefully assess the opportunity from both financial and operational perspectives.

Start by evaluating market demand. Businesses that solve real customer problems and meet ongoing needs are more likely to succeed. Research customer demographics, purchasing behavior, and industry growth before making a decision.

Next, study the competition. Instead of avoiding competitive industries, identify ways to differentiate your business through better service, innovation, pricing, or customer experience.

Financial planning is equally important. Calculate startup costs alongside recurring expenses such as salaries, marketing, insurance, technology, and operational overheads. This helps determine how long your business can operate before becoming profitable.

You should also assess the business’s profit potential by reviewing expected revenue, customer acquisition costs, profit margins, and return on investment. Businesses with recurring revenue models generally provide greater financial stability.

Businesses often sell products or services on credit to attract more customers and build long-term relationships. While this is a common practice, it also creates a challenge. Payments may take 30, 60, or even 90 days to arrive, but business expenses continue every day.

To bridge this gap, many businesses use receivables financing solutions like bill discounting and factoring. Both help businesses unlock cash from unpaid invoices instead of waiting for the payment due date. Although they serve a similar purpose, the way they work is quite different.

If you’re wondering which option is better for your business, this guide explains the key differences, benefits, and use cases of bill discounting and factoring.

What Is Bill Discounting?

Bill discounting is a financing method where a business receives funds against its unpaid invoices or bills before the payment due date.

Instead of waiting for customers to pay, the business approaches a bank, NBFC, or financing platform. The financier advances a large portion of the invoice value after deducting a discounting charge. Once the buyer pays the invoice, the transaction is settled.

In most cases, the business continues to own the invoice and maintains its relationship with the buyer.

Bill discounting is commonly used by MSMEs and businesses that supply goods or services to large corporates with established payment cycles.

What Is Factoring?

Factoring is another type of invoice financing where a business sells or assigns its outstanding invoices to a factoring company.

The factor immediately pays a significant percentage of the invoice amount. The remaining balance, after deducting applicable fees, is paid once the buyer clears the invoice.

Unlike bill discounting, the factoring company often takes responsibility for collecting payments from customers. Some factoring arrangements also include receivables management, credit monitoring, and collection services.

Factoring is suitable for businesses that want both working capital and assistance in managing outstanding receivables.

Bill Discounting and Factoring

Although both financing methods improve cash flow, they differ in several important ways.

Ownership of the Invoice

In bill discounting, the ownership of the invoice usually remains with the seller. The financier simply provides funds against the invoice.

In factoring, the invoice is assigned to the factoring company for financing purposes. Depending on the agreement, the factor manages the receivable until payment is received.

Collection of Payment

With bill discounting, the seller generally continues to collect payment from the buyer.

In factoring, the factoring company often collects the payment directly from the customer.

This is one of the biggest differences between the two financing methods.

Customer Relationship

Businesses using bill discounting continue managing customer communication and payment follow-ups.

With factoring, customers may interact directly with the factoring company regarding invoice payments.

Businesses that prefer maintaining complete control over customer relationships often choose bill discounting.

Confidentiality

Bill discounting is usually confidential. Buyers may not know that financing has been taken against the invoice.

Factoring is generally disclosed because customers are informed to make payments to the factoring company.

Services Offered

Bill discounting mainly provides financing against invoices.

Factoring usually offers additional services such as:

  • Invoice collection
  • Receivables management
  • Credit monitoring
  • Customer payment follow-up
  • Sales ledger management

These services reduce the administrative burden on businesses.

Cost

Bill discounting generally involves financing charges or discounting fees based on the invoice value and financing period.

Factoring may include financing charges along with service fees for managing receivables and collections.

Because of these additional services, factoring can sometimes cost more than bill discounting.

Suitable Businesses

Bill discounting is generally suitable for businesses that:

  • Have established customer relationships
  • Want faster access to working capital
  • Prefer handling customer collections themselves
  • Supply to creditworthy buyers

Factoring is more suitable for businesses that:

  • Want to outsource receivables management
  • Have limited finance teams
  • Need assistance with payment collection
  • Want additional credit management services

Risk Management

  • Bill discounting: the seller often remains responsible if the buyer fails to make payment, depending on the financing agreement.
  • Factoring, the level of risk depends on whether the arrangement is recourse or non-recourse factoring. In non-recourse factoring, the factor may bear the credit risk under agreed conditions.

How TReDS Supports Bill Discounting

The Trade Receivables Discounting System (TReDS) has made bill discounting easier and more transparent for MSMEs in India.

TReDS is an RBI-regulated electronic platform where MSME sellers can upload invoices that have been accepted by corporate buyers or government entities. Multiple financiers then bid to finance these invoices, allowing businesses to receive funds before the payment due date.

Platforms like RXIL help MSMEs unlock working capital through a fully digital process with competitive discounting rates.

Some key benefits include:

  • Faster access to working capital
  • Digital invoice financing
  • Transparent bidding by multiple financiers
  • No need to wait for long payment cycles
  • Better cash flow management

For MSMEs supplying to large organisations, TReDS has become an efficient way to manage receivables without relying solely on traditional business loans.
